Service account: qdep-scaler. The Plumbline autoscaler reads queue depth from the Ferrytail broker every 15s and adjusts worker counts on the Granite cluster. It runs as the qdep-scaler account, read-only on queues, write on deployments. If scaling stalls, check token expiry first — it's the usual cause. Restarting the scaler pod forces re-auth. The account authenticates to the Ferrytail metrics endpoint with the key below.

gateway credential: kto3_qfe

Big one this release: Quarrel CI builds for the Lintbarrow suite are now fully hermetic — no more network fetches mid-build, all deps pinned and vendored through Cratchit. Reproducibility checks pass on three consecutive runs, which honestly felt like a miracle.

Because the old signing key lived on the legacy builder, we rotated it as part of the cutover. Anything signed pre-3.2.0 should be treated as stale. Release manager: please update the verification config with the new signing key below.

rollout seal: bky4_x7Gc

CI note: If the partner SFTP drop step fails in the Quillhaven ingest pipeline, first check whether the upstream partner rotated their host key — this is the cause roughly nine times out of ten. The pipeline pins known keys, so a rotation makes the transfer step exit early with a verification error, not a timeout. New team members should not retry blindly; confirm the key change with the integrations channel first. When escalating, include the pipeline build identifier shown below.

session token of yahof-bajeg = htk9_0d43d44ed

Welcome to Schemahaven, our event schema registry. Short version: producers can't publish an event unless its schema is registered and backward-compatible. If compatibility checks page you at 3am, it's almost always a renamed field — reject it, don't override. Registry config changes deploy through the usual pipeline and must be signed. The current deploy key is below.

deploy key for kajof-fajop: bky6_gDHw9Q